  • Patent number: 11241327
    Abstract: A wearable posture enhancement device triggers muscles in the body to act to enhance posture of the body. The posture enhancement device is not a brace and does not apply any forces to the body sufficient to force the body to move to any position or hold any position. The posture enhancement device includes a torso strap, arm straps, and a posture signaling panel. The torso strap is configured to hold the posture enhancement device to a human body at a first pressure level. The posture signaling panel extends from a front of the torso strap to a back of the torso strap. The posture signaling panel is configured to provide a second pressure level to the human body, and the second pressure level signals muscles to correct posture of the human body. The second pressure level is less than the first pressure level.

  • Patent number: 7487630
    Abstract: A jet engine includes a fan arranged upstream of a core engine having a low pressure compressor, a high pressure compressor, a combustion chamber, a high pressure turbine, and a low pressure turbine. The high pressure turbine is drive-connected to the high pressure compressor. The low pressure turbine is drive-connected through a transmission to the low pressure compressor and to the fan, which are respectively driven in opposite rotation directions. A compressor disk of the low pressure compressor is positioned downstream directly after the fan so that a hub end section of the fan and the compressor disk together form a counter-rotating compressor stage.

  • Patent number: 7134667
    Abstract: A sealing arrangement for turbomachines with a shaft bearing, a throw-off ring and a shaft seal which is assigned to a sealing gap and has a seal housing wherein opposing faces of the throw-off ring and the seal housing form an annular gap for centrifuging out dirt and oil particles.

  • Patent number: 5326647
    Abstract: An abradable layer for labyrinth seals of a turbo-engine, particularly a gas turbine is provided. The labyrinth is made of a layered composite material with a core and a shell and embedments. A process for the manufacturing of this abradable layer is provided. In this case, the core is made of a felted or three-dimensionally crosslinked fiber body made of iron base, nickel base or cobalt base alloys and the shell consists of one or several precious metals or precious-metal alloys. Each core is completely surrounded by the shell material, in which case the embedments consist of oxidation-stable sliding materials of the oxide, carbide or nitride group with a hexagonal crystal lattice layer structure.

  • Patent number: 4899959
    Abstract: A gas turbine power plant, especially for helicopters, includes a main engine and a reduction gear transmission forming a self-sufficient auxiliary modular unit. A compensating arrangement includes an articulated outer cover and a shaft section inside said outer cover connected for transmitting power and for compensating any position disalignment between the main engine and the helicopter main gear drive. The reduction gear transmission is directly, rigidly force-coupled to the helicopter main gear drive, and the compensating arrangement including the articulated outer cover and shaft section is located between the main engine and the reduction gear transmission, whereby the axial length spacing between the main engine and the helicopter main gear drive is substantially reduced.

  • Patent number: 4709546
    Abstract: A cooled gas turbine power plant has a compressor and a high pressure turbine connected to the compressor. The cooling air quantity for the turbine is controlled in response to instantaneous load conditions and in direct response to the cooling air quantity control of the compressor. This control of the cooling air quantity for the turbine is achieved by a direct mechanical coupling of a slide valve for the turbine cooling air control with the control of the compressor, whereby good power output values and low fuel consumption values are achieved for the high pressure turbine, especially under partial load operating conditions. The compressor may be controlled by an adjustment of the angular position of its guide vanes or blades or by an adjustment of the quantity of its discharge air.

  • Patent number: 4578942
    Abstract: A gas turbine engine is so constructed that the clearance or gap between the rotor and stator, especially at the outer diameter range of a radial flow end stage, is optimally maintained under all operating conditions. For this purpose the housing in the axial-flow/radial-flow compressor is constructed as a two shell housing. The outer housing shell is mounted as part of the engine structure, whereby the inner housing shell is exposed substantially only to forces or loads caused by compressor fluid flow. The material of the outer housing shell has a heat expansion coefficient in the axial direction of the rotational engine axis, which is distinctly lower than the heat expansion coefficient of the material of the compressor rotor. The heat expansion coefficient of the material of the inner housing shell is lower in the circumferential direction and approximately equal in the axial direction relative to the heat expansion coefficient of the rotor.

  • Patent number: 4439982
    Abstract: An annular sleeve surrounds a turbine rotor and is fixed to a stationary part, the sleeve being elastically deformable in a radial direction. A wear ring is carried by the sleeve, the wear ring being composed of segments arranged end-to-end circumferentially. The adjacent ends of the segments are spaced apart at all operating conditions of the turbine. The thermal expansions of the turbine rotor and of the sleeve and ring are so related that under operating conditions of the turbine, when the engine of which it forms a part is running, the sleeve thermally expands radially. The rate of thermal expansion of the stationary part is directly related to the rate of thermal expansion of the turbine rotor. Air leaving the compressor is directed against the sleeve and the stationary part carrying the sleeve. The wear ring and portion carrying the sleeve may be insulated. The sleeve may be mounted on a combustion chamber surrounding the turbine.

  • Patent number: 4419952
    Abstract: An apparatus for detecting and for optically indicating from afar the temperature condition of an upper layer of a road surface includes a thermally conductive temperature sensor positioned within the upper layer of the road surface to sense the temperature thereof. A temperature indicator is positioned on a post above the road surface. The temperature indicator includes a liquid crystal agent having a first optically perceivable condition substantially at a temperature above the freezing point of water and a second optically perceivable condition substantially at a temperature below the freezing point of water. A thermally conductive connector thermally connects the temperature sensor and the liquid crystal agent, such that the temperature sensed by the sensor is conveyed to the liquid crystal agent, whereby the liquid crystal agent exhibits the respective condition thereof representative of the temperature of the road surface.

  • Patent number: 4390318
    Abstract: An arrangement for operating shut-off members in gas turbine engines, particularly turbojet engines. Circumferential rotation of an actuating ring is converted into axial opening or closing movement by transmission element. These transmission elements are in the form of bellcranks which are pivotally supported in their elbow area on a fixed casing of the engine. A free arm end of each bellcrank is hinged to the actuating ring. Another free end of each bellcrank is hinged to a pull rod engaging at least one axially moveable shut-off member, or an axially adjustable shut-off element thereon. Two pull rods associated with respective shut-off members, are each pivotally connected on a side opposite the associated shut-off members at various points of an arm of the bellcrank. The arrangement is such that co-directional movement of the shut-off members produces different travels or strokes of the shut-off members.

  • Patent number: 4314791
    Abstract: This invention relates to a variable stator cascade for axial-flow turbines of gas turbine engines, especially for high-pressure turbines, where the turbine nozzle vanes are each pivotally arranged about an axis of rotation and are cooled when in operation. The inner and outer rings of the variable stator cascade are formed of interlocking inner and outer ring segments which provide circumferential sealing action where each turbine nozzle vane is pivotally arranged and disconnectably connected by respective root and tip side pivot pins in association with each respective inner and outer ring segments. A continuous inner stator ring, is centrally located at inner ring segments of the stator cascade by means of teeth and a slot-and-key arrangement whereby each outer ring segment arranged at the turbine casing cooperates with the vane attachment assembly to radially guide the nozzle vane and associated inner ring segment.

  • Patent number: 4273512
    Abstract: A compressor rotor wheel construction and a method of making same is provided which includes a blade portion of heat-resistant metallic material, a rotor disk portion made of a high-strength metallic material, and a steel spacer ring arrangement connecting the blade and rotor disk portions. The steel spacer rings are connected by explosion welding to the blade portion, are then finish machined, as is the rotor portion, and then the spacer rings are connected respectively to the rotor disk portion by brazing or welding.

  • Patent number: 4264272
    Abstract: A gas turbine engine in which a centrifugal diffusor is located downstream of a centrifugal compressor. The compressor air flow from the centrifugal diffusor is deflected into an axial direction by a substantially 90 degree elbow. The air flow is further decelerated in an axial-flow stator cascade upstream of the combustion chamber. A main bearing of the gas generator is arranged immediately downstream of the centrifugal compressor. This bearing is supplied from the outside through vanes of the axial-flow stator cascade. The axial-flow stator cascade is divided into groups of vanes, so that each group had a number of relatively small guide vanes and one relatively large guide vane. The small guide vanes are designed from the view point of fluid mechanics consideration, while the larger guide vane of a group is hollow for supplying the bearing. The large guide vane has a substantially longer and a substantially thicker vane profile than the small vanes.
